Material and Coating
The material and coating of the screw are crucial in determining its performance and lifespan. Stainless steel sheet metal screws are made from various grades of stainless steel, including 18-8, 304, and 316. The grade of stainless steel used will affect the screw’s corrosion resistance, strength, and durability. For instance, 18-8 stainless steel is a general-purpose grade that offers good corrosion resistance and is suitable for most applications. On the other hand, 316 stainless steel is more resistant to corrosion and is often used in marine and high-humidity environments.
The coating on the screw is also an essential factor to consider. Some common coatings include zinc, chrome, and silver. These coatings provide additional corrosion protection and can enhance the screw’s appearance. However, it’s essential to note that some coatings may not be suitable for certain environments or applications. For example, zinc-coated screws may not be suitable for use in high-temperature applications due to the risk of zinc corrosion. When choosing a stainless steel sheet metal screw, it’s crucial to consider the material and coating to ensure that it meets your project’s requirements.
Screw Type and Drive
The type and drive of the screw are also critical factors to consider. There are various types of stainless steel sheet metal screws, including pan head, flat head, and round head. Each type of screw has its unique characteristics and is suited for specific applications. For instance, pan head screws are ideal for applications where a low-profile screw is required, while flat head screws are suitable for applications where a strong, flush finish is needed. The drive type of the screw is also essential, with common drive types including Phillips, slotted, and Torx. The drive type will affect the ease of installation and the screw’s resistance to cam-out.
The choice of screw type and drive will depend on the specific requirements of your project. For example, if you’re working with thin sheet metal, a pan head screw with a Phillips drive may be the best option. On the other hand, if you’re working with thicker material, a flat head screw with a Torx drive may be more suitable. It’s essential to consider the screw type and drive to ensure that it meets your project’s requirements and provides a secure and reliable fastening solution.

How do I install stainless steel sheet metal screws?
Installing stainless steel sheet metal screws is a relatively straightforward process. The first step is to drill a pilot hole in the material being used, using a drill bit that is slightly smaller than the screw. This will help to guide the screw into place and prevent it from slipping or stripping. Next, the screw can be inserted into the pilot hole and driven into place using a screwdriver or drill. It is essential to use the correct type of screwdriver or drill bit to avoid damaging the screw or surrounding material.
It is also essential to ensure that the screw is driven into place at the correct angle and depth. The screw should be driven into place at a 90-degree angle to the material being used, and should be driven to the correct depth to provide a secure fastening solution. Over-tightening or under-tightening the screw can cause damage to the surrounding material, or can result in a loose or insecure fastening solution. Additionally, it is essential to use the correct type of screw for the specific application and material being used, as this can affect the ease of installation and the overall quality of the fastening solution.
